Commentaire sur la fiche : Comment obtenir une liste numérotée et peut-on choisir un type de numérotation (chiffres romains, lettres, etc.) ?
Si la réponse à cette question ne vous parait pas claire ou si elle vous semble obsolète, n’hésitez pas à nous en faire part.
Et nous sommes preneurs également de toute correction de faute d’orthographe ou de grammaire...
Rappel du texte de la fiche :
Il n’existe pas de syntaxe spécifique à proprement parler pour faire une liste numérotée. Pour en faire une, il faut faire une liste normale et de lui donner l’attribut [(variant=ol)]
comme le montre l’exemple ci-dessous.
[(variant=ol)]
- Premier élément
_ deuxième paragraphe du premier élément
- Deuxième élément
- Troisième élément
Premier élément
deuxième paragraphe du premier élément
Deuxième élément
Troisième élément
L’utilisation de cet attribut est compatible avec les autres attributs comme la classe.
[(variant=ol c=M)]
- Premier élément
- Deuxième élément
Premier élément
Deuxième élément
La balise HTML <ol>
possède trois attributs particuliers start
qui indique de commencer la liste à partir d’un certain nombre, reversed
qui prend la liste dans l’ordre inverse (ne fonctionnera qu’avec un navigateur récent) et type
qui indique le type de numérotation. Ces attributs peuvent être indiqués de la même manière que l’on indique la classe de la liste (précisions : ces mécanismes sont propres au HTML, ils ne s’appliqueront pas à l’affichage de la fiche au format ODT).
start
et reversed
[(variant=ol start=50 reversed=reversed)]
- 50ème place
- 49ème place
50ème place
49ème place
L’attribut type
prend une des valeurs suivantes :
1
: chiffresA
: lettres majusculesa
: lettres minusculesI
: chiffres romains majusculesi
: chiffre romains minuscules
[(variant=ol type=i)]
- Premier élément
_ deuxième paragraphe du premier élément
- Deuxième élément
- Troisième élément
Premier élément
deuxième paragraphe du premier élément
Deuxième élément
Troisième élément
Terminons par un exemple de listes imbriquées reproduisant une aborescence avec un type de numérotation différent à chaque niveau. On remarquera qu’il faut déclarer à toute nouvelle liste de niveau inférieur quel est son type
[(variant=ol type=A)]
- Premier élément de niveau 1
[(variant=ol type=1)]
-- Niveau 2
[(variant=ol type=i)]
--- Niveau 3
-- Niveau 2 (deuxième élément)
- Deuxième élément de niveau 1
[(variant=ol type=1)]
-- Deuxième liste de niveau 2
Premier élément de niveau 1
Niveau 2
Niveau 3
Niveau 2 (deuxième élément)
Deuxième élément de niveau 1
Deuxième liste de niveau 2